89ers knock off Tom JIM-sula in 225.02-119.36 rout

89ers stepped up and beat their projected point total, cruising to a 225.02-119.36 win over Tom JIM-sula, who fell short of projections. 89ers never trailed in this one after grabbing a 25.9-point lead on Saturday behind Fred Warner (21.8 points) and Deshaun Watson (13.4). Philip Rivers (279 Pass Yds) and Leonard Fournette (71 Rush Yds, 34 Rec Yds) did their part for Tom JIM-sula in the loss. This marks the second time this season 89ers have taken down Tom JIM-sula, after falling 186.92-160.24 in their last matchup. 89ers end the season at 12-4, while Tom JIM-sula finish the campaign at 9-7.
